§ 9:6B-3 — Definitions.
New Jersey·Title 9 CHILDREN--JUVENILE AND DOMESTIC RELATIONS COURTS
3.As used in this act: "Child placed outside his home" means a child placed outside his home by the Department of Human Services, the Department of Children and Families, the Department of Health, or a board of education. "Department" means the Department of Human Services, the Department of Children and Families, the Department of Health, or board of education, as applicable. L.1991, c.290, s.3; amended 2006, c.47, s.71; 2012, c.17, s.19.
